Arnold Smith Wins Function Ent. $20K Shootout at JEGS Door Car Fling

Arnold Smith wheeled the “Natural High” ‘69 Nova to the Function Enterprises $20,000 Shootout win at the JEGS Performance Door Car Fling presented by OPTIMA Batteries at GALOT Motorsports Park.

In the final, Arnold Smith from Roseboro, NC was one hundredth over the dial against the four-thousandths breakout of Phillip Truitt from Salisbury, MD to pick up the $20,000 big check in the 32-Car Shootout Wednesday evening.

At four cars, Phillip Truitt was .004 at the starting line and took .005 at the stripe for the win against the dead-on nine lap of Eric Aman. Arnold Smith and Connor Caulder were separated by five thousandths at the hit, with Smith having the advantage and crossing the finish line first by .007 to advance past Caulder.

Logan Westmoreland, Arnold Smith, Tanner Miller, Phillip Truitt, Larry Chapman, Eric Aman, Chris Dixon, and Connor Caulder appeared in the ladder round. Westmoreland was .005 and .001 short at the top end to give the win to Smith, while Truitt put his Camaro dead-on zero to eliminate Miller. Aman was .005 on the tree to put together a .019 package against the .020 bulb of Chapman. Caulder let go .009 for the win over Dixon.

Gate entries are welcome and doubles are permitted each day. Three-day entries for the Friday, Saturday, and Sunday $25K’s are available for $650, or racers can purchase a single day entry for $275.
